Bernardaud Chateaubriand Couleur Bread & Butter Plate
Best luxury heirloom porcelain for sophisticated formal dinner parties.
A fresh, modern take on a classic 1970s floral motif. By stripping away gold detailing and focusing on layered blue tones, this piece offers a sophisticated, understated elegance for the table.

Performance breakdown
Design Versatility
The simplified blue palette pairs effortlessly with both modern and traditional settings.
Material Quality
Limoges porcelain construction offers a signature translucent finish and exceptional durability.
Aesthetic Depth
Layered blue tones create a sophisticated, three-dimensional effect on the floral motif.
Ergonomic Handling
The 6.3-inch diameter provides a balanced, comfortable weight for table service.
Pattern Precision
Clean lines and sharp detailing elevate the classic 1970s floral inspiration.
Collection Cohesion
Understated design allows it to integrate seamlessly into existing fine china sets.
